About MDCalc

MDCalc provides online point-of-care clinical decision-support tools for healthcare professionals, including a library of medical calculators, equations, scores, and clinical practice guidelines. It offers tools such as the Creatinine Clearance (Cockcroft-Gault Equation), weight-based levothyroxine dosing, CKD-EPI GFR equations, mean arterial pressure, and SpO₂/FiO₂ ratio, and is available as a mobile app.

The Opportunity

Since 2005, MDCalc has been an essential part of the clinician’s workflow to help achieve better patient outcomes. Actively used by more than 65% of physicians worldwide, MDCalc is the most broadly used medical reference – at the point-of-care – for clinical decision tools and content, and one of only four references used by >50% of US HCPs. These evidence-based tools and content are used by millions of medical professionals globally and support 50+ specialties and cover 200+ patient conditions.
